Description
Fresh strawberry salad with gorgonzola, cucumber, toasted almonds, and homemade strawberry balsamic dressing. Ready in just 10 minutes!
Ingredients
For the Salad:
5 oz mixed lettuce greens
1 lb fresh strawberries, sliced
1 large cucumber, chopped
4 oz crumbled gorgonzola cheese
1/3 cup slivered almonds, toasted
For the Strawberry Balsamic Dressing:
2 tablespoons finely chopped shallots
1/4 cup extra virgin olive oil
2 tablespoons balsamic vinegar
2 tablespoons strawberry jelly
2 tablespoons fresh-squeezed orange juice
Salt and pepper to taste
Instructions
- Add chopped shallots, olive oil, balsamic vinegar, strawberry jelly, fresh orange juice, salt, and pepper to a blender. Blend until completely smooth and emulsified, about 20 seconds. Taste and adjust salt if needed.
- Slice strawberries into thin rounds or quarters. Chop cucumber into bite-sized pieces. Toast slivered almonds in a dry skillet over medium heat for 2 to 3 minutes until fragrant.
- Add mixed lettuce greens to a large salad serving bowl. Top with sliced strawberries, chopped cucumber, crumbled gorgonzola, and toasted slivered almonds.
- Drizzle the strawberry balsamic dressing over the salad. Toss gently to coat everything evenly. Serve immediately.
Notes
Store dressing separately in a sealed jar in the fridge for up to 5 days. Prep all ingredients ahead and store separately for up to 2 days. Toss together right before serving so the lettuce stays crisp. Swap gorgonzola for feta, goat cheese, or blue cheese. Add grilled chicken, shrimp, or salmon to make it a full meal.
